Authentication is a critical aspect of using SOCKS5 proxies, especially when credentials are required for access. One common mistake users make is misconfiguring the authentication settings. The SOCKS5 protocol supports username and password authentication, but if the credentials are entered incorrectly or the authentication method is not supported by the server, the connection will fail.
How to avoid it:
- Double-check the username and password: Make sure the credentials are entered exactly as provided by the proxy service.
- Verify authentication settings: Some SOCKS5 proxies require specific authentication methods, such as no authentication or anonymous access. Make sure the selected method matches the server configuration.
- Test login: Before configuring the proxy for full use, test the authentication with a simple connection attempt to ensure everything works as expected.
Another frequent issue is the incorrect entry of the proxy’s IP address and port number. A SOCKS5 proxy works by routing internet traffic through a server, and if the proxy server’s IP address or port is wrong, the connection will not be established.
How to avoid it:
- Confirm the IP address and port: Verify the IP address and port number provided by your proxy provider, ensuring they are correctly entered into your settings.
- Check the proxy format: SOCKS5 proxies typically use port 1080, but some providers may use custom ports. Ensure that the format matches the recommended one.
- Test the connection: Before using the proxy for full browsing, always run a test to ensure that the connection to the proxy server is successful.
When using a SOCKS5 proxy, DNS resolution can sometimes become a stumbling block. Many users fail to configure DNS correctly, which results in DNS requests bypassing the proxy and revealing the user’s actual IP address. This undermines the purpose of using a SOCKS5 proxy for anonymity.
How to avoid it:
- Use proxy-aware DNS settings: To prevent DNS leaks, configure your system or application to use DNS servers that are proxy-aware, ensuring DNS queries are routed through the proxy.
- Test for DNS leaks: Use online tools to test if your DNS requests are being routed through the proxy. If not, adjust your settings accordingly.
- Enable DNS over HTTPS (DoH): If your proxy service allows it, enable DNS over HTTPS to further secure your DNS queries.
In some cases, the firewall or antivirus software on your system can block the SOCKS5 connection, leading to failed proxy setups. Firewalls often prevent unauthorized access to your network, which may inadvertently block the communication between your device and the proxy server.
How to avoid it:
- Allow proxy traffic in the firewall: Make sure that your firewall is configured to allow traffic through the port used by the SOCKS5 proxy.
- Add exceptions for proxy applications: If you are using a specific application or browser for proxy use, ensure it is allowed through the firewall or antivirus program.
- Temporarily disable antivirus: As a troubleshooting step, you can temporarily disable antivirus software to see if it is interfering with the proxy connection. However, ensure you enable it again after testing.
Some users make the mistake of setting up a SOCKS5 proxy system-wide without ensuring that specific applications are configured to use it. For example, web browsers, torrent clients, or other apps that support SOCKS5 may still bypass the proxy if not configured individually.
How to avoid it:
- Configure applications manually: Many applications allow you to configure proxy settings separately from the system’s global proxy configuration. Ensure that these applications are set to route traffic through the SOCKS5 proxy.
- Use application-specific settings: For web browsers like Firefox or Chrome, you can configure SOCKS5 settings directly in the browser’s proxy settings, allowing you to route only specific traffic through the proxy.
- Confirm connection: After configuring the proxy for individual applications, check whether the proxy is functioning as expected by visiting a "What is my IP" website to verify that the application is using the proxy.
While SOCKS5 proxies can enhance privacy, they are not inherently secure, especially when no encryption is used. A common mistake is to assume that using a SOCKS5 proxy alone guarantees security. Without additional security measures, such as encryption or using a secure connection, your internet traffic can still be intercepted by third parties.
How to avoid it:
- Use secure protocols: When setting up a SOCKS5 proxy, consider pairing it with additional security protocols like HTTPS or encryption tools to safeguard your data.
- Monitor for leaks: Use tools to monitor for potential IP and DNS leaks, ensuring your traffic remains anonymous.
- Opt for secure SOCKS5 services: If possible, choose a SOCKS5 proxy service that offers additional security features, such as encryption, to ensure that your internet traffic is not exposed.
